Analisando propostas

Analisar estrutura atual de cloud na Aws e transformá-la em Iac (preferencialmente usando Terraform)

Publicado em 19 de Outubro de 2021 dias na TI e Programação

Sobre este projeto

Aberto

Analisar estrutura atual de cloud na AWS e transformá-la em IaC (preferencialmente usando Terraform).

A estrutura atual é composta pelos seguintes serviços:
- ECS: cluster com 3 services Fargate (API em NodeJS, Queue System em NodeJS e Redis) e 1 service EC2 (MongoDB)
- CodePipeline: 2 pipelines
  1- Pipeline API: deploy automatizado da API para os services do ECS API e Queue System
  2- Pipeline APP: deploy automatizado de app React em bucket do S3 (que conta com CloudFront para distribuição)
- S3: 2 buckets, um para deploy do APP React e outro para armazenamento estático de arquivos enviados pelos usuários
- RDS: PostgreSQL
- CloudFront
- EC2 ELB
- EFS
- Route 53
- Lambda: duas funções
  1- Invalidação de cache: disparada pela CodePipeline do APP para invalidação do cache do CloudFront (para servir à todos os usuários a nova versão)
  2- Gerador de thumbnail: tem como gatilho o upload de videos ao bucket de arquivos dos usuários, gera automaticamente uma thumbnail para os videos

Categoria TI e Programação
Subcategoria Outros
Tamanho do projeto Pequeño
Isso é um projeto ou uma posição de trabalho? Um projeto
Tenho, atualmente Não se aplica
Disponibilidade requerida Conforme necessário

Prazo de Entrega: 29 de Outubro de 2021

Habilidades necessárias

Outro projetos publicados por Giorgio F.